cce部署seata
时间: 2024-05-31 07:06:15 浏览: 175
CCE是华为云容器引擎,而Seata是一款开源的分布式事务解决方案,它提供了一系列的解决方案来解决分布式事务的问题。在CCE中,可以通过以下步骤来部署Seata:
1. 创建Kubernetes Namespace,例如seata-ns。
2. 部署Seata Server。可以通过以下命令来创建Seata Server:
```
kubectl create -n seata-ns -f https://raw.githubusercontent.com/seata/seata/master/server/src/main/resources/nacos-server-standalone.yaml
```
3. 部署Seata TC(事务协调器)。可以通过以下命令来创建Seata TC:
```
kubectl create -n seata-ns -f https://raw.githubusercontent.com/seata/seata/master/config/standalone/all-in-one/seata-server.yml
```
4. 部署Seata RM(资源管理器)。可以通过以下命令来创建Seata RM:
```
kubectl create -n seata-ns -f https://raw.githubusercontent.com/seata/seata/master/config/standalone/all-in-one/seata-server.yml
```
5. 创建Seata配置文件。可以参考Seata官方文档中的配置文件模板,并将配置文件存储到Kubernetes ConfigMap中。
6. 部署应用程序。在应用程序中,需要添加Seata客户端依赖,并在应用程序中配置Seata客户端相关参数。
阅读全文